THREATENED CLOSING OF PUB-LIC-HOUSES IN DUNEDIN.

[BY SELEGEAPH.—PRESS ASSOCIATION.] Dokedin, Wednesday. It is stated that a conference o£ the Dunedin Licensing Committees has been held, and a decision come to to close all hotels in the city but the four principal ones—The Grand, Wain's, the City, and Criterion. The Licensed Victuallers' Association held a meeting to-day, and resolved that the time has now arrived when more unanimous action should be taken in reference to their interests. A committee was appointed to consider matters affecting the trade, and to call a further meeting shortly.
